In contemporary society, the entertainment industry plays a significant role in shaping cultural norms and values. Through various mediums such as movies, music, television, and theater, celebrities and media personalities have a profound influence on the public. The power of celebrity culture goes beyond mere entertainment; it can also impact societal trends, behaviors, and attitudes.

One key aspect of celebrity culture is the influence of celebrities as role models. Celebrities often serve as role models for their fans, especially younger audiences who look up to them for inspiration and guidance. Their actions, choices, and behaviors are closely watched and emulated by their fans. This influence can have both positive and negative effects, as celebrities have the power to shape opinions, promote social causes, or set trends.

Moreover, the fashion choices of celebrities have a significant impact on popular culture. What celebrities wear, how they style their hair, and the accessories they use often become trends that are adopted by the public. Fashion designers and brands often collaborate with celebrities to create exclusive lines or promote their products, capitalizing on the influence of celebrity endorsements.

The entertainment industry also plays a crucial role in shaping public discourse and promoting social issues. Celebrities often use their platform to raise awareness about important social causes such as environmental conservation, mental health awareness, or social justice issues. Through their influence and reach, celebrities can amplify these messages and inspire their fans to take action.

Despite the positive aspects of celebrity culture, there are also negative implications to consider. The constant scrutiny of celebrities by the media and the public can lead to issues of privacy invasion, mental health struggles, and unrealistic expectations. Celebrities are often under immense pressure to maintain a flawless image, leading to issues such as body shaming, substance abuse, or mental health disorders.

In conclusion, celebrity culture is a complex and multifaceted aspect of modern society. While celebrities have the power to influence public opinion, shape cultural trends, and raise awareness about important social issues, there are also negative implications to consider. As fans and consumers, it is essential to critically engage with celebrity culture, understanding the impact it has on our society and being mindful of the messages and values it promotes. Ultimately, the influence of celebrity culture is a reflection of our society’s values, beliefs, and aspirations.
